Carter then came in but was quickly caught by Scott at third man, while the new-corner, Dr. Law, retired almost at once well caught by Bingham the younger off Metcalfe . At 53 Smith fell to Mitchell, and at 54 Mitchell again did the needful by bowling Dr . Nicholson with a grand ball . After this the bowling seemed to be anything but good, as Atkinson and Waterhouse were allowed to score very fast, but at last Waterhouse succumbed to one of Mitchell's fast "yorkers ." The last man caused very little trouble, the innings ending for 77. At 4 o ' clock Mitchell and Naylor took the wickets opposed by W. M . Carter and Atkinson . At 16 Mitchell was forced to retire being extremely well caught and bowled by W . Carter. Bingham (2) then joined Naylor, but before making much of a score was unfortunately given out lbw . Whitby then paid a very short visit to the wickets, the first ball being too much for him . After this disastrous state of affairs Metcalfe went in and stayed a little time, during which Naylor was bowled for a steady innings of 8, and Scott being soon disposed of, Carter joined Metcalfe, who was soon after bowled . Of the rest the less said the better, as they all, Carter the one bright exception, seemed to have forgotten that it is necessary to stop a straight ball. NORTH RIDING ASYLUM.
